文章詳情頁
php+mysql 高并發 根據id 循環下載數據如何避免重復 (接口)
瀏覽:178日期:2022-06-06 14:54:21
問題描述
比如 表內容為
id name
1 a
2 b
3 c
4 d
第一次 下載 id為1
第二次 下載 id為2
第三次 下載 id為3
第四次 下載 id為4
id為4完畢后又從1開始 ,一直無限循環,要能支持高并發!
之前我用的是 把id 保存在另一個表里面,每次下載從表里面讀取最后一次的id,下載數據時就,要大于這個id的數據 就行了,但是高并發會下到重復的數據,而且要操作另一個表有點麻煩,有沒有大神有其他好的方法!
問題解答
回答1:加延遲啊或者array_unique,你主要的是不要下載重復的數據,又不是下載id來用相關文章:
1. node.js - mongodb查找子對象的名稱為某個值的對象的方法2. html5 - datatables 加載不出來數據。3. 運行python程序時出現“應用程序發生異?!钡膬却驽e誤?4. docker 下面創建的IMAGE 他們的 ID 一樣?這個是怎么回事????5. 利用IPMI遠程安裝centos報錯!6. 前端 - @media query 使用出現的問題?7. javascript - 在 model里定義的 引用表模型時,model為undefined。8. 測試自動化html元素選擇器元素ID或DataAttribute [關閉]9. javascript - QQ第三方登錄的問題10. html5和Flash對抗是什么情況?
排行榜

網公網安備